Check out the savages with the accu trigger. By far the best stock barrell you can get on a factory gun.
As far as caliber, I am partial to the .20's for yotes. I really like the .204 I have, fast shooter and hardly ever get an exit on a yote. Saves on the hides if that is what you are interested.
If you dont care about the hide, go with a .223 or a 22-250. Bullets are cheap and can be had darn near anywhere.

I have two savages in the mold 10 one in 22-250 and the other is a 243 win
Both guns have the accu triggers. I have both set at around 1 1/2 you cannot beat these guns for shooting both print under an inch. I have Brownings and other guns but the Savages get the most use. I also am a lefty but don't have one left handed bolt, I shoot all right handed bolts.
For scopes I like to gather all the light I can. We use 44 up to 50mm objectives. The power of the scope should fit the land you hunt. Around here we hunt high lines, big timber cuts and frozen lakes. We due hunt the timber, this is where we use the smaller guns like the 17 HMRs and shot guns.
